In Lankan Filling Station, O Tama Carey continues the journey from her acclaimed debut Lanka Food, presenting a vibrant, playful collection of Sri Lankan-inspired dishes that blend tradition with modern creativity. The book showcases the unique and inventive flavors of Lankan Filling Station, featuring recipes such as crab curry jaffles, white pepper brisket biryani, and devilled chicken livers. With dishes ranging from spiced jaggery tarts and beetroot pickle rotis to hopper pizzas and caramelised chilli popcorn, this cookbook celebrates the essence of Sri Lankan cuisine while embracing bold, fun twists that make each dish a delight. Building on her deep-rooted knowledge of Sri Lankan culinary traditions, Carey invites readers to explore her diverse and imaginative creations. Each recipe reflects her passion for flavor and her commitment to making food both delicious and enjoyable. Ferment: Simple Recipes From My Multicultural Kitchen by Kenji Morimoto Ferment gives you all that’s needed to start your fermented foods adventure - whether you want to make simple pickles, dive into lactofermentation, or discover flavor-packed meals to cook with your homemade (or store-bought!) ferments. Pickles and ferments bring so much flavor and variety to meals, and they’re much easier to make than they seem. Enter third-culture cook and fermenting expert Kenji Morimoto, who shows just how simple it is to introduce homemade kimchi, sauerkraut, kombucha, miso, super-quick pickles, and more into your everyday cooking with delicious, gut-healthy results. Recent research encourages us to eat thirty plants a week to help our microbiome to thrive.
